How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Monroe City?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Monroe City Studio Apartments | $1,508 | $600 | $1,750 |
Monroe City 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,094 | $695 | $2,279 |
Monroe City 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,319 | $779 | $4,399 |
Monroe City 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,570 | $1,055 | $2,214 |
Monroe City 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,400 | $1,300 | $1,500 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Monroe City
How much are Studio apartments in Monroe City?
There are currently 2 Studio Apartments in Monroe City with rent ranges from $600 to $1,750 with an average price of $1,508.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Monroe City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Monroe City ranges from $695 to $2,279 with an average monthly rent of $1,094.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Monroe City c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Monroe City range from $779 to $4,399.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,319.
How expensive are Monroe City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 17 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Monroe City on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,055 to $2,214 - averaging $1,570 for the location.
